When a pair is suspended, the primary system stops performing journal-obtain operations for the
pair. However, the primary system continues the following operations:

Continues accepting write I/Os for the suspended P-VOL

Keeps track of the P-VOL cylinders/tracks that are updated

Keeps track of journal data discarded during the pair suspension. (Both primary and secondary
systems do this.)

A split or suspended S-VOL has a separate consistency status that indicates its update sequence
consistency with respect to the other S-VOLs in the associated journal. Consistency status displays
on the secondary system only.

Table 3 (page 67)

describes S-VOL consistency statuses.

When the pair is re-synchronized, the primary and secondary systems perform the following
operations:

The secondary system sends the S-VOL bitmap to the primary system

The primary system merges the P-VOL and S-VOL bitmaps to synchronize the tracks

These actions ensure that all cylinders/tracks containing journal data discarded on the secondary
system are re-synchronized.

Monitoring Cnt Ac-J pair synchronous rate

You can check on the percentage of synchronized data between the P-VOL and S-VOL.

Procedure 14 To check a pair’s synchronous rate

1.

In the Storage Systems tree, click Replication > Remote Connections.

2.

Click the Cnt Ac-J Pairs tab, then select the pair whose rate you want to display.

3.

Click Actions > Remote Replication > View Pair Synchronous Rate.

Clicking Refresh View displays the latest synchronous rate.

Monitoring Cnt Ac-J operations history

You can review a pair’s history of operations, including each operation’s description, the date
and time the operation took place, primary and secondary system information, and other details.

Procedure 15 To view a pair’s operation history

1.

In the Storage Systems tree, click Replication.

2.

From the Actions menu, click Remote Replication > View Histories.

3.

In the Histories window, for Copy Type, make sure Cnt Ac-J is selected.
